De Novo Assembly of Plasmodium knowlesi Genomes From Clinical Samples Explains the Counterintuitive Intrachromosomal Organization of Variant SICAvar and kir Multiple Gene Family Members

<p>Published DOI:&nbsp;<a href="https://doi.org/10.3389/fgene.2022.855052">https://doi.org/10.3389/fgene.2022.855052</a></p> <p>Supporting data for the attached publication. De Novo assembled genomes of&nbsp;<em>Plasmodium knowlesi</em>&nbsp;generated using Nanopore long reads. Supporting statistical results are included. Variant call files from structural variant calls are attached for each genome. Additionally, statistical results from BUSCO, QUAST, Pomoxis and AGAT are included. Annotation files in GFF3 format including further analyses of these annotation files are attached. Scripts for post analysis are attached with scripts for data generation presented on Github repository: &quot;Pknowlesi_denovo_genome_assembly&quot;</p>

Allen Brain Atlas

Allen Brain Atlas is an Allen Institute collection of brain map atlases, datasets, APIs, and analysis tools covering mouse, human, and non-human primate brain resources.

Annotated Behaviour and Observability Dataset (ABODe)

ABODe is a University of Edinburgh DataShare dataset for behavior classification in group-housed mice using home-cage video, identities, bounding boxes, ground-plate positions, and annotator labels.

DANDI Archive for NWB datasets

DANDI is a BRAIN Initiative archive for publishing and sharing neurophysiology data, including electrophysiology, optophysiology, and behavioral data packaged as NWB and related standards.

International Brain Laboratory public data

The International Brain Laboratory public data releases expose standardized mouse decision-making experiments, including Neuropixels recordings, widefield calcium imaging, behavior, and session metadata accessed through the ONE API.

OpenNeuro

OpenNeuro is a free, open platform for sharing neuroimaging datasets, with public search, dataset pages, and download paths for web, S3, DataLad, and the OpenNeuro CLI.
